How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Packwaukee?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Packwaukee Studio Apartments | $1,068 | $925 | $1,150 |
Packwaukee 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,147 | $735 | $1,639 |
Packwaukee 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,408 | $740 | $2,350 |
Packwaukee 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,773 | $995 | $2,600 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Packwaukee Apartments with Washer/Dryer
What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in Packwaukee?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Packwaukee with Washer/Dryer is at STANTON STREET ESTATES listed at $840.
How much is the average rent for Packwaukee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in Packwaukee with Washer/Dryer is $993.
What is the largest Packwaukee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Packwaukee is a 1,292 square feet unit starting from $840 at STANTON STREET ESTATES.
What is the average size for Packwaukee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Packwaukee is currently at 781 sq ft.
